Statistical Tools and Methodologies for Ultrareliable Low-Latency Communication—A Tutorial

Onel L. A. López,
Nurul H. Mahmood,
Mohammad Shehab
et al.

Abstract: This article provides a tutorial on several statistical tools and methodologies that are useful for designing and analyzing ultrareliable low-latency communication systems.
